Teachers' Experiences with Technology Integration in Design-Based Learning

Science teachers in Turkiye who underwent a professional development program with mentoring support in a national project reported mixed results on technology integration in design-based learning (DBL) activities. The research, conducted by Sinop University, involved 43 science teachers who received face-to-face and online training, as well as mentoring, to evaluate lesson plans and technology integration. The study found that teachers mainly integrated technology into DBL activities rather than the design process, but recommended improving professional development programs to address the challenges of technology integration.
